Research Abstract

The purpose of this project is to examine the material design of novel phosphors for VFD (Vacuum Fluorescence Display) with high fluorescence intensity from a viewpoint of structural low-dimensionality such as magnetoplumbite structure etc. Generally, a luminous phosphor for VFD should be requested to keep some electric conductivity owing to the prevention of some space charges. In this context, we also investigated the fabrication of novel pyrochlore type oxides which consisted of rare earth metals as luminous centers and host lattice with Ti^<4+> and Sn^<4+> ions being semiconductive.
As a result, we succeeded to make novel phosphors in the solid solution of Eu^<3+> and Pr^<3+> pyrochlores for VFD. The resulting compounds were identified as single phase of pyrochlore and observed the intense emission by a cathodeluminescence technique after adjusting the suitable concentration of luminous center ions.
On the other hand, CaAl_2B_2O_7;Eu^<2+> phosphor was newly synthesized as PDP's (Plasma Display Panel's) use. According to the XRD data, the structure was precisely determined to a layered spinel structure with BO_3 and AlO_4 blocks which were more available for the 147nm-excitation(i.e., Xe gas excitation).
